Company Visit – Power Assets Holdings Ltd.

04.07.2012

The Hong Kong Council of Social Service (HKCSS) organized a half-day Company Visit on 4 July 2012 for students of the HKU-FUDAN IMBA Program. The visit enabled the participants to learn more about the knowledge and global trends on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R), and how local corporations integrate CSR into their business operations and long-term strategic planning.

The event consisted of two parts. In the first part, Mrs. Brenda Lee, Consultant of The HKCSS-Caring Company Scheme, and Ms Mimi Yeung, General Manager (Public Affairs) of Power Assets Holdings Limited (Power Assets) shared topics on CSR in Hong Kong, and CSR development of Power Assets. In the second part, there was a tour to the control centre of Power Assets, located at Apleichau. Besides, the representatives of Power Assets also introduced the new Electric vehicles (EVs) scheme that aims at improving air quality in Hong Kong.

Some 60 IMBA students joined the event. During the sharing session, participants showed interest in the CSR practices as well as the development of CSR between Hong Kong and Mainland China.

Through this event, the participants understood more about the CSR strategies and implementation of corporations in Hong Kong.
